Output f89b106897627abe75fb18d1dc71158c7afc7da84fecd0855b600b0b579221bb:1

value
17076885540
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26d5b75da4a1ac52b005ca6e58d2a52190721cf3 OP_EQUALVERIFY OP_CHECKSIG
address
14YLhZH5VpW7PHaWq8EzsAnqFJ1ia9bkhZ
transaction
f89b106897627abe75fb18d1dc71158c7afc7da84fecd0855b600b0b579221bb
spent
true